An exemplary leader in Catholic education

Award winning Principal
Posted on 03/11/2022
Linda Dipasquale

An “exemplary leader whose dedication to faith-filled service is evident in the school communities she has served, and the multitude of students she has helped learn and grow” has been selected by her peers as the Principal of the Year among Catholic schools in Ontario.


Linda Dipasquale, Principal at St. Joseph’s Catholic Elementary School in River Canard, will receive the Principal of the Year award from the Catholic Principals’ Council of Ontario at their annual general meeting next month.


“I am extremely honoured and deeply humbled by this special acknowledgement,” said Dipasquale, who has been with the WECDSB for 35 years, the last 13 as an administrator. “I have been blessed to work with many incredible students, school faculty, colleagues, parish partners, and school communities and am grateful for the many rewarding moments and experiences. It has truly been an honour to have fulfilled my dream of being a Catholic educator and the opportunity to make a positive difference in the lives of others.”


A recent grandmother and the daughter of immigrant parents who modelled a selfless commitment to serving others, Dipasquale was acknowledged by CPCO for her tireless work ethic, an attribute affirmed by WECDSB Director of Education Emelda Byrne.


“Linda has always had high expectations for herself and the people around her,” said Byrne, “but she also strives to create a warm, loving and caring atmosphere in the classrooms and the schools where she has worked. During her tenure with our Catholic school board she has touched the lives of countless students and their families who are better just for having known her.”


Board Chair Fulvio Valentinis echoed those sentiments.


“Linda is a shining example of everything you could hope for in a Catholic school administrator,” he said. “She is a humble, faith-filled servant leader who wants nothing but the best for all of those around her. We are extremely grateful for her years of service and for setting the gold standard for other administrators to follow.”
